The researcher staff shall be seconded under the best conditions possible for the time of the exchange. Provided that this requirement is met, it is up to the beneficiary to manage the EU unit costs (no minimum per category).
As for the reporting, the REA will request the submission of the researcher declaration (RD) and the corresponding periodic report (According to article 19.1). You will not be requested to report on each category but the corresponding number of units (person- months) per researcher month per beneficiary.
In the case of an audit, each beneficiary shall keep proof of the time for the secondments (boarding pass, visas, etc…) as normal accounting practice.
